Output d3fab575fb7ddd88f28de593691acf87d8b70ad5c47f863a866d95e9bb2e6e16:1

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 202e27359230ecc1e13317c7b882e1eb9c625ce1 OP_EQUAL
address
34dAqTeKC4d5jr38i4EZrM7ixFgCoxYMpK
transaction
d3fab575fb7ddd88f28de593691acf87d8b70ad5c47f863a866d95e9bb2e6e16
confirmations
266496
spent
true